#6da059 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6da059 is composed of 42.7% red, 62.7%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 103.1 degrees, a saturation of 28.5% and a lightness of 48.8%. #6da059 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ffb2 with #004100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#6da059

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060905 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6da059

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8376 is the less saturated color, while #47f603 is the most saturated one.
